Systematic is fundamental to biology because it is foundation for all studies on all organisms and in understanding with conservation issues. The Flora of Ranikhet, West Himalaya is an attempt to explain the components of angiosperms and gymnosperms. The present Flora describes 934 plant species with 925 angiosperms (125 families) and 9 gymnosperms (4 families). The Angiosperms includes 772 dicots (105 families) and 153 monocots (20 families). The complete list of grasses, exotic gymnosperms and pteridophytes were also provided. The present flora is useful for nature lovers, taxonomist, researchers, students, ecologist, conservationist, local communities, trekkers and tourist etc.

"Traditional knowledge systems are multi-faceted area of wisdom gained through millennia of experience, direct observation, and the word of mouth. These systems are better preserved in the Himalayan region. Traditional knowledge awaits its currently relevant wider application for human benefit. This volume gives an account of folk medicine, agroforestry, traditional land management, conservation of monuments, plants used in folk-culture, legal aspects of traditions, role of informatics in TKS, conservation, storage and biodiversity of traditional vegetable, horticultural crops and other economic plants. Articles on adulteration in Saffron and basic methods for obtaining 'patent' are also included. This book will hopefully be of interest to ethnobotanists, pharmacologists, anthropologists, horticulturists, lawyers and planners." (jacket).

Aggiungi al carrelloHardcover. Condizione: New. 1st Edition. Aquaculture is the farming of fish, crustaceans, molluscs, aquatic plants, and other aquatic organisms. Aquaculture involves cultivating freshwater and saltwater populations under controlled conditions, and can be contrasted with commercial fishing, which is the harvesting of wild fish. It is commonly known as aqua farming. According to the Food and Agriculture Organization (FAO), aquaculture is understood to mean the farming of aquatic organisms including fish, molluscs, crustaceans and aquatic plants. Farming implies some form of intervention in the rearing process to enhance production, such as regular stocking, feeding, protection from predators, etc. Farming also implies individual or corporate ownership of the stock being cultivated.
